Popis:For this case study, the teacher training needs of the Brunca Region regarding the teaching of English represented the object of analysis. To inquire about these needs, the researchers created a series of focus groups and questionnaires with different participants from the regional curriculum: experts, representatives of public universities, employers, teachers, and students, who provided inputs for an inductive analysis through the qualitative approach. The results reflect that the teaching of English in the region requires promoting the incorporation of elements of critical applied linguistics (LAC), information and communication technologies (ICT), and the teaching of English for specific purposes in the classroom (EFS). Thus, the authors conclude that a specialization program in the teaching of English that considers the aforementioned elements can have a positive impact on the quality of education, competitiveness, and the humanistic training required to generate higher levels of social and economic well-being in area.
